Rampakoto in context

With 519 people at the 2011 Census, Rampakoto was the 1145th most populous of its district's 2123 villages, below the district average of 729.

Literacy stood at 56.11%, 10.4 points below the district's rural average of 66.53%.

The sex ratio was 1227 women per 1,000 men (228 above the district's rural figure of 999)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1179, 256 above the rural national 923.
